IS THERE ANY MINIMUM RQUIREMENT TO DEFINE CONTEXT?..

Answer / bhavesh232

Once you start using contexts in a universe, every single
join must belong to at least one context. A join can belong
to more than one context, but if it doesn't belong to any
it is considered by BusinessObjects to be isolated from the
rest of the universe structure.
